On Tuesday, President Donald Trump is scheduled to posthumously bestow the Presidential Medal of Freedom upon the conservative youth leader during a White House ceremony.

Taking place in the East Room, the event marks what would have been Kirk’s 32nd birthday and will gather prominent individuals associated with Trump’s political agenda.

Kirk passed away on Sept. 10, while addressing an event at Utah Valley University, which was meant to be the start of a college campus tour where he would engage students in political debates. A controversial personality with a large audience, Kirk frequently stirred contention by challenging liberal viewpoints. He was known for disseminating unsubstantiated claims, such as Haitian migrants in Ohio consuming people’s pets, labeling the Civil Rights Act a “significant error,” and asserting that fatalities from firearms were an acceptable consequence for preserving Second Amendment protections.

His demise occurred amidst an escalation of political unrest in the U.S. Instances include Trump supporters aggressively breaching police lines to obstruct the certification of presidential election outcomes on Jan. 6, 2021; an attacker assaulting Speaker Nancy Pelosi’s husband, Paul, with a hammer; a suspected arsonist setting Governor Josh Shapiro’s Pennsylvania residence ablaze while his family slept; the killing of Minnesota House Democratic leader Melissa Hortman in her home; and two assassination attempts targeting Trump during his campaign last year.

Trump and his supporters have pointed to Kirk’s killing as justification for advocating measures they claim combat political violence. During a special episode of Kirk’s podcast last month, hosted by Vice President JD Vance, Vance urged a comprehensive government initiative to probe and disband left-wing groups in the nation that he asserts incite violence. On Sept. 22, the administration declared a domestic terrorist organization, despite the fact that “antifa” does not denote a singular, organized group but rather broadly refers to anti-fascist protestors who lack a formal structure.

During Kirk’s memorial service, held in the crowded State Farm Stadium in Glendale, Arizona last month, Trump asserted that history would perpetually remember Kirk and that “his name will endure eternally in the annals of America’s most esteemed patriots.”

The Presidential Medal of Freedom is typically presented to individuals to acknowledge “a lifetime of notable accomplishments in the arts, public service, science, or other areas,” as per the Congressional Research Service’s description of the accolade. Past honorees of this medal include Babe Ruth, Elvis Presley, Tiger Woods, Rush Limbaugh, Pope Francis, Hillary Rodham Clinton, Anna Wintour, Michelle Yeoh, and Denzel Washington.
